Output 43d893880c9301e3c9f852a2aa7a1c661e081a09f7e6dda69d99042e5608f3ee:0

value
305559
script pubkey
OP_0 OP_PUSHBYTES_20 daca3e2603212796ccad08e856a11d2478592fda
address
bc1qmt9rufsryynedn9dpr59dggay3u9jt76e48dtx
transaction
43d893880c9301e3c9f852a2aa7a1c661e081a09f7e6dda69d99042e5608f3ee
spent
true